The authors investigated the effect of small additive amounts of nonmagnetic ions as Na", Caz+, ZrZ+, Sb3+ and binary or ternary combinations of these ions on some physical properties of the (Lio,sFe,,,)o,6Zno,4Fe,0, ferrite used in high frequency. It was found that by the segregation of these additives on the grain boundaries, the grain growth is diminished and much higher sintered densities are obtained in several cases, though not all. We established that additives such as Na,O, CaO, ZrO, enhance the rate of sintering, giving a speedy start to the sintering process. All additives improve the electrical resistivity due to insulating intergranular layers generated by segregation of additives.
